首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Linux上安装Oracle Instantclient而不设置环境变量?

在Linux上安装Oracle Instantclient而不设置环境变量,可以通过以下步骤实现:

  1. 下载Oracle Instantclient安装包:

首先,访问Oracle官方网站下载Oracle Instantclient的安装包。选择适合您的Linux发行版的版本,并按照说明进行下载。

  1. 解压安装包:

使用tar命令解压下载的安装包,例如:

代码语言:txt
复制

tar -xvzf instantclient-basic-linux.x64-19.10.0.0.0dbru.zip

代码语言:txt
复制
  1. 创建一个新的目录:

创建一个新的目录,例如:

代码语言:txt
复制

mkdir /opt/oracle

代码语言:txt
复制
  1. 将解压后的文件复制到新目录:

将解压后的文件复制到新创建的目录中,例如:

代码语言:txt
复制

cp -r instantclient_19_10/* /opt/oracle

代码语言:txt
复制
  1. 创建一个新的软链接:

创建一个新的软链接,例如:

代码语言:txt
复制

ln -s /opt/oracle/libclntsh.so.19.1 /opt/oracle/libclntsh.so

代码语言:txt
复制
  1. 运行Oracle Instantclient:

在不设置环境变量的情况下,可以使用以下命令运行Oracle Instantclient:

代码语言:txt
复制

LD_LIBRARY_PATH=/opt/oracle/ /path/to/your/oracle/client/binary

代码语言:txt
复制

其中,/path/to/your/oracle/client/binary是您的Oracle客户端二进制文件的路径。

请注意,这种方法在某些情况下可能会导致问题,因为它不会将Oracle Instantclient添加到系统路径中。因此,在生产环境中,建议设置环境变量以确保Oracle Instantclient可以正确地运行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

windows10,redhat6.5下python3.5.2使用cx_Oracle链接oracle

0.序言 项目主要使用oracle但是我不太喜欢其他编程语言,加上可能需要用python部署算法包,从oracle表中读出数据,处理完成后放回oracle中去,所以windows就想到先用python...所以还是需要姜python等插件部署linux服务器上面,下面就分享一下红帽主机下使用python的插件cx_Oracle(注意大写)入库。...2.1 Linux下多个版本的python共存 Linux下默认系统自带python2.6的版本,这个版本被系统很多程序所依赖,所以建议删除,如果使用最新的Python3那么我们知道编译安装源码包和系统默认包之间是没有任何影响的...or directory 2、设置相应用户的环境变量: 在这里需要说明下,你使用哪个帐户装cx_Oracle就需要配置哪个帐户的环境变量,以下已root帐户为例; 如果不配置环境变量、或环境变量配置不正确...注意此处的两点小的不同:cursor.execute(create_tab) 产生任何输出,这是因为它是一个 DDL 语句, (76,) 是一个有单个元素的字节组。

85530

Ubuntu Linux 安装 Oracle Java 14的方法

最近,Oracle 宣布 Java 14(或 Oracle JDK 14)公开可用。如果你想进行最新的实验或者开发的话,那么你可以试试 Linux 系统安装 Java 14。...本教程中,我将向你展示 Ubuntu 系统安装 Java 14 的简便方法。请继续阅读。...如何在 Ubuntu Linux 安装 Java 14? 作为参考,我已成功默认安装 OpenJDK 11 的 Pop!_OS 19.10 上成功安装了它。...如果要在 Debian 和其他 Linux 发行版安装它,那么也可以按照Linux Uprising 中的详细指南安装 Java 14。...到此这篇关于 Ubuntu Linux 安装 Oracle Java 14的方法的文章就介绍到这了,更多相关Ubuntu Linux 安装 Oracle Java 14内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持

1.5K21
  • Greenplum使用oralce_fdw连接oracle

    目录下(主节点) instantclient-basic-linux.x64-12.2.0.1.0.zip、 instantclient-sdk-linux.x64-12.2.0.1.0.zip、...instantclient-sqlplus-linux.x64-12.2.0.1.0.zip三个文件包 #解压缩,并修改目录为instantclient mv instantclient_12_2 instantclient...下载地址(永久有效): 链接:https://pan.baidu.com/s/1qxLyMKUBnrjL960TGzMcZg 提取码:6pb9 2 root和gpadmin用户下配置环境变量(主节点...客户端到所有节点 1、用gpadmin用户把 /data/instantclient 发送到其他的segment节点的相同目录下 2、并把master节点环境变量发送到其他的segment的节点...# vi oracle-x86_64.conf /data/instantclient # ldconfig 注:如果执行上述步骤,create extension时会报错: 8 创建oracle_fdw

    1.3K00

    Oracle 安装 与 卸载 以及 使用 plsqldev

    开头的所有项目,该目录是注册的Oracle事件日志 3.删除环境变量path中关于oracle的内容。...—– 删除PATH环境变量中关于Oracle的值时,将该值全部拷贝到文本编辑器中,找到对应的Oracle的值,删除后,再拷贝修改的串,粘贴到PATH环境变量中,这样相对而言比较安全。...三、Oracle 客户端的安装 注意:装的是32位客户端,这是因为 Oracle 服务器 装的是 64 位的 , plsqldev 没有64 位的 , 只有 32 位 的 ,...一开始 plsqldev 的登录界面 是没有 ‘连接为’ 的选项, 数据库 名也是空的 开始配置 因为 现在 服务器基本都是 64 位的 , plsqldev...(2)将系统的tnsnames.ora拷贝到该目录下 (3)PLSQL Developer中设置Oracle_Home和OCI Library Oracle_Home: C:\instantclient-basic-nt

    96110

    连接远程数据库ORACLE11g,错误百出!

    安装ORACLE1g 首先,我已经提前虚拟机上配置了windows2008+oracle11g,为什么用server2008呢?...我们老师为了让我们更清楚区分数据库软件安装和数据库配置,所以安装oracle11g的时候选择的是”只安装数据库软件“(记得是第二个选项),然后安装的时候字符集都设置的UTF8,其他的配置基本都是保持的默认...好了,安装的事情细说,一般情况下只要是主机没问题,检测条件通过,安装都是不成问题的,下面就开始了配置数据库。...然后,connection中安装图示设置instantclient的位置。 ? 很重要的一步,到虚拟机注册表中查看NLS_LANG的值,若无此路径则直接查找NLS_LANG,复制此键值。 ?...再次尝试连接,如果还是连接,尝试重启ORACLE数据库!

    78600

    cx_Oracle模块的安装

    cx_Oracle模块的安装两部分 ---- 环境设置 Linux系统为 Centos 6.8 Python环境为 Python 3.6 Oracle 模块:cx_Oracle Oracle客户端:Oracle...这里我们下载上图圈出来的2个rpm包(需要注册Oracle账号) oracle-instantclient12.2-basic-12.2.0.1.0-1.x86_64.rpm oracle-instantclient12.2...-devel-12.2.0.1.0-1.x86_64.rpm ---- 安装Oracle客户端(root用户) rpm -ivh oracle-instantclient12.2-basic-12.2.0.1.0...-1.x86_64.rpm rpm -ivh oracle-instantclient12.2-devel-12.2.0.1.0-1.x86_64.rpm ---- 添加ORACLE_HOME用户环境变量.../usr/lib/oracle/12.2/client64/lib ---- 2.下载cx_Oracle模块 我们知道Python强大的在于他强大的模块功能,不论你想做什么都有相应的轮子供我们使用,今天介绍的是专门用于连接

    1.1K40

    Oracle免客户端For .Net(增加分析Devart和DataDirect)

    其实只要按照这个流程来做,基本不会有错误,要错也只是TNS错而已。最令人忍受不了的就是,Oracle客户端实在是无比庞大,尽管后来可以只安装Oracle客户端运行时,仍然很大。...但打包的时候才发现,InstantClient安装文件虽然不到30M,但是安装之后足足139M(下图实际是最新的驱动2.112.2.0,网上的InstantClient是2.112.1.0,两者文件基本一样...当然,光有OCI目录(环境变量Path中设置)不行,还得设置环境变量ORACLE_HOME为OCI目录,否则报错(因为oci.dll要用别的dll): OCIEnvCreate 失败,返回代码为...设置环境变量ORACLE_HOME为oracle9i310目录,环境变量Path中添加其下的bin目录(oci.dll在里面)。测试正常!这表明,9i运行时支持绿色发布。...运行时 支持 支持 OCI目录设置方式 环境变量Path中设置 环境变量Path中设置或配置文件设置DllPath或注册表设置DllPath 其它环境变量 需要设置ORACLE_HOME 无 运行时安装包大小

    2.1K100

    Oracle 11g即时客户端windows下的配置

    Oracle 11g即时客户端windows下的配置 by:授客 instantclient-basic-nt-11.2.0.3.0.zip客户端压缩包为例 步骤 1....(注意位于其他Oracle目录之前),增加系统环境变量TNS_ADMIN,系统环境变量ORACLE_HOME,系统环境变量NLS_LANG 此例中值如下: ORACLE_HOME=D:\Program...,然后菜单工具-首选项中填写如下内容 Oracle主目录名:D:\Program Files\instantclient-basic-nt-1.2.0.3.0\instantclient_11_2...1、服务器端字符集一般安装Oracle数据库时都会选择中文字符集,如果不是,那只能通过其他方法修改了。...还可以dos窗口里面自己设置,比如: set NLS_LANG =SIMPLIFIED CHINESE_CHINA.ZHS16GBK 这样就只影响这个窗口里面的环境变量

    2K20

    NodeJs连接Oracle数据库

    实现步骤简介 1、下载解压需要安装包(2个) 2、添加环境变量 3、npm执行安装命令 4、查询demo代码 5、常见错误解决方案 安装详情 1、下载解压需要安装包(2个) 下载页面:http://www.oracle.com...-12.1.0.2.0.zip 把两个文件解压到“C:\oracle\instantclient_12_1”文件目录不同,不会相互覆盖。...2、添加环境变量 OCI_INC_DIR=C:\oracle\instantclient_12_1\sdk\include OCI_LIB_DIR=C:\oracle\instantclient_12_...如果本机安装oracle服务器端,请把次环境变量如下地址: OCI_INC_DIR = C:\app\Administrator\product\11.2.0\dbhome_1\oci\include...c:\xxx\oracledb.node… 解放方案:服务器安装版本与环境变量的OCI_INC_DIR、OCI_LIB_DIR版本不符,设置版本为一致的即可,参照上面步骤2,配置完成之后,删除之前下载的

    4.4K100

    SQL*Plus安装指南

    安装SQL*Plus 获取SQL*Plus 传送门 基于Windows平台 注:笔者PC安装的是Oracle 12c Release 2,根据你的安装版本下载对应工具即可。...创建一个新的文件夹,SQL*Plus下载页获取instantclient-basic-windows.x64-12.2.0.1.0.zip和instantclient-sqlplus-windows.x64...通过cmd命令行工具 配置PATH环境变量 依次点击 “此电脑 -> 右键 -> 属性 -> 高级系统设置 -> 环境变量 -> 选中Path -> 新建(如果是WIN Server 200X则应选择编辑...注:实际建议Path路径中使用中文,此处为演示方便,生产中建议使用全英文路径 ?...添加字符集变量 登录数据库查询所用字符集:select userenv('language') from dual; 依次点击 “此电脑 -> 右键 -> 属性 -> 高级系统设置 -> 环境变量 -

    6.5K20

    连接远程数据库ORACLE11g,错误百出!

    安装ORACLE1g 首先,我已经提前虚拟机上配置了windows2008+oracle11g,为什么用server2008呢?...我们老师为了让我们更清楚区分数据库软件安装和数据库配置,所以安装oracle11g的时候选择的是”只安装数据库软件“(记得是第二个选项),然后安装的时候字符集都设置的UTF8,其他的配置基本都是保持的默认...好了,安装的事情细说,一般情况下只要是主机没问题,检测条件通过,安装都是不成问题的,下面就开始了配置数据库。...7.然后,connection中安装图示设置instantclient的位置。 ? 8.很重要的一步,到虚拟机注册表中查看NLS_LANG的值,若无此路径则直接查找NLS_LANG,复制此键值。...再次尝试连接,如果还是连接,尝试重启ORACLE数据库!

    1.6K00

    Java代码远程操作oracle数据库,执行sql文件、备份、回滚

    imp|exp 是oracle导入导出工具,由于要备份回滚,所以我们也要安装这两个命令工具。...下载工具包 oracle官网去下载三个包: 依赖基础库:instantclient-basic-windows.x64-12.1.0.2.0.zip sqlplus命令行工具:instantclient-sqlplus-windows.x64...-12.1.0.2.0.zip 安装工具 SQL*Plus命令行工具无需执行exe安装,所以只需将下载回来的两个文件解压到同一个目录即可,解压后文件名应该为instantclient_12_1,在运行工具之前我们需要在...windows中配置以下环境变量,先右键计算机->属性->高级系统设置->环境变量: 系统变量中找到Path并在后面加上刚才解压后instantclient_12_1的目录与sdk子目录 E:\...:\instantclient_12_1\sdk; set TNS_ADMIN=E:\instantclient_11_2 set NLS_LANG=AMERICAN_AMERICA.UTF8 到此则一切工具安装完毕

    2.1K20

    plsqldev 日期格式

    之前装 win7 + oracle 11 R2 (64) + instantclient_11_2 (32) + PLSQL(32) 费了很大力气,见前一个帖子,后果就是plsql启动时读的环境变量位置是五花八门...,可能是注册表中oraclehone下的,也可能是instantclient下的或者是电脑高级属性中环境变量,当然start.bat中的设置优先。...\oraclehome] “NLS_TIMESTAMP_FORMAT”=”YYYY-MM-DD HH24:MI:SS:FF6” 注册表中设置Oracle环境变量的地方(也就是设置...ORACLE_HOME的地方)设置NLS_TIMESTAMP_FORMAT的格式(也就是创建这样一个字符串项,然后设置它的值为你、转换需要的掩码,我一般设置为YYYY-MM-DD HH24:MI:SS:...帖子三: 修改ORACLE-NLS_DATE_FORMAT时间格式的四种方式 1.可以在用户环境变量中指定(LINUX)。

    2K20

    oracle连接plsqldev

    PLSQL Developer 1.本机是win10(64位)安装PLSQL Developer 9时没有出现像PLSQL Developer 11那样的版本不匹配的问题。...,先登录,直接进入页面,tools->preferences->connection(工具–首选项–连接)中配置Oracle Home(Oracle 主目录)和OCI library(OCI库),配置如下...注:完成第二步,可不需要进行第三步环境变量配置,重启plsql developer若不能正常使用在进行下面配置 三、配置环境变量 控制面板\系统和安全\系统\高级系统设置\环境变量\系统变量...我的PLSQL 9和instantclient 32位的可以,用PLSQL 11就必须下载instantclient x64的(下载地址:http://download.csdn.net/detail/...ORA-12504:TNS:监听程序CONNECT_DATA中未获得SERVICE_NAME 解决:我的是登录的时候数据库名写的未对应配置中的连接名,必要情况重启TNS服务。

    1.2K10

    PLSQLDeveloper14连接Oracle11g

    文章目录 一、环境配置 1.安装PLSQLDeveloper14 2.下载并解压Oracle客户端 3.配置window操作系统环境变量 二、工具配置 1.Oracle客户端配置 2.PLSQLDeveloper14...配置 3.重启PLSQLDeveloper14客户端 结尾 ---- 一、环境配置 1.安装PLSQLDeveloper14 官网自行下载,不详细阐述 2.下载并解压Oracle客户端 例如版本:instantclient-basic-nt...-19.8.0.0.0dbru.zip 3.配置window操作系统环境变量 电脑(右键)→属性→高级系统设置环境变量→系统环境变量→新建 变量名:NLS_LANG 变量值: AMERICAN_AMERICA.ZHS16GBK...变量名:TNS_ADMIN 变量值:D:\work\java\software\instantclient_19_11 二、工具配置 1.Oracle客户端配置 Oracle客户端...主目录 :将Oracle客户端解压目录到Oracle主目录 我本机的路径为:D:\work\java\software\instantclient_19_11 2.添加OCI库:将Oracle客户端解压目录下

    41810
    领券